Musk, Hanson, and a Stabbing Case That Reignited Australia’s Political Divide

Australia has become the center of a heated political debate after a violent attack on veteran paramedic Kathryn McCormack triggered questions about public safety, sentencing laws, and the protection of frontline workers.

What began as a disturbing criminal incident has rapidly evolved into a much broader national conversation involving politicians, emergency services personnel, social media commentators, and even some of the world’s most recognizable public figures.

The controversy intensified after reports emerged that the alleged attacker avoided a prison sentence under circumstances that many Australians found difficult to understand.

As details circulated online, frustration grew.

For many people, the issue quickly expanded beyond the specifics of one case.

Instead, it became a symbol of larger concerns about crime, justice, and whether governments are doing enough to protect those who serve the public.

That frustration gained further momentum when comments attributed to billionaire entrepreneur Elon Musk began circulating across social media platforms.

The remarks, which criticized Australia’s handling of public safety issues, immediately generated widespread attention.

Supporters praised Musk for highlighting concerns they believed were being ignored.

Critics questioned whether international figures should involve themselves in complex domestic political debates.

Regardless of perspective, the comments succeeded in amplifying an already explosive discussion.

The incident involving McCormack struck a particular nerve because paramedics occupy a unique place in public life.

They are often among the first people to arrive at emergencies.

They work in unpredictable environments.

And they routinely place themselves in situations that carry significant risks.

Many Australians therefore view attacks on emergency workers as especially serious offenses.

The expectation is simple.

Those who respond to crises should be protected while performing their duties.

When incidents occur that appear to challenge that principle, public reactions are often strong.

As the story spread, questions emerged regarding how existing laws treat assaults against emergency personnel.

Supporters of stronger penalties argued that current protections are insufficient.

They contend that frontline workers deserve additional legal safeguards because of the risks associated with their jobs.

Others emphasized the importance of examining legal details carefully before drawing conclusions.

The debate soon moved beyond the courtroom and into the political arena.

This is where Pauline Hanson entered the discussion.

Hanson has long positioned herself as an advocate for tougher approaches to crime and law enforcement.

Her response was therefore unsurprising to many observers.

She argued that emergency workers, including paramedics, police officers, firefighters, and other first responders, deserve stronger protections.

According to Hanson, governments have a responsibility to ensure that those who protect communities receive meaningful support from the legal system.

Supporters embraced the message immediately.

Many argued that frontline workers face increasing dangers while performing essential public services.

They believe stronger penalties would serve both as punishment and deterrence.

Critics, however, warned against simplifying complex legal issues into political slogans.

They argued that sentencing decisions often involve numerous factors that may not be immediately visible in public reporting.

This disagreement reflects a broader pattern in Australian politics.

Questions surrounding crime and public safety frequently become flashpoints for larger debates about government priorities, social policy, and public confidence in institutions.

The McCormack case appears to have become one such flashpoint.

The involvement of Musk added another layer to the story.

Although not directly involved in Australian politics, his enormous online following gives his comments significant visibility.

When public figures of that scale weigh in on controversial issues, discussions often expand rapidly beyond national borders.

This is precisely what happened here.

International audiences began paying attention.

News outlets picked up the story.

Social media engagement surged.

And the debate became part of a broader conversation about governance and public trust.

The remarks attributed to Musk focused heavily on accountability.

The central argument was that governments must prioritize the safety of citizens and frontline workers if they wish to maintain public confidence.

This message resonated with many people because trust remains one of the most important resources available to democratic institutions.

When citizens believe laws are functioning effectively, confidence grows.

When they perceive inconsistencies or weaknesses, confidence can decline rapidly.

That dynamic helps explain why cases involving emergency workers often attract such strong reactions.

They touch on questions of fairness, responsibility, and public expectations.

The political implications are also significant.

Prime Minister Anthony Albanese and the governing Labor Party are already confronting numerous challenges.

Cost-of-living pressures remain a major concern.

Housing affordability continues dominating headlines.

Immigration, energy policy, and economic management are all subjects of intense political debate.

The emergence of another highly emotional issue only increases pressure.

Opposition parties and minor parties alike are eager to capitalize on public dissatisfaction.

One Nation, in particular, has increasingly positioned itself as a voice for Australians frustrated with mainstream political responses.

Incidents such as this provide opportunities to reinforce that message.

Whether such efforts translate into lasting political gains remains uncertain, but the strategy is clear.
